
'Bird lady' Krissy Stanley is an institution in the Sutherland Shire and now you could own her Oyster Bay home.
The pink walls and kitchen create a spectacle in the three-bedroom abode, which has "a lot of character", according to selling agent, Gavin Hill, of Highland Property Group.
When the Leader spoke on the phone with Mr Hill and Mrs Stanley, the duo were cooing over a chicken in a tutu that was reportedly strutting through the kitchen.
Mrs Stanley is best known for her business, Kris's Feathered Friends, which has her take an array of stunning hand-reared birds into aged care facilities to entertain the elderly.
Kris and her feathered mates have featured on Better Homes and Gardens, Fat Pizza, Housos, The Living Room and more, and now she plans to move to a smaller, single-level home to cater for her birds.
The home at 84 Georges River Crescent offers 'massive potential' at a sought-after address, according to the property listing.
Mrs Stanley said the home was "like a tree house, we're up high and we have beautiful views from every window, with water glimpses, bush and trees, it's leafy and open plan, like a big old country cottage."
She said it would make a "great family home" as it offered a big fenced-in pool and grassy front yard.
Mr Hill said the two-street access provided potential for dual occupancy - subject to council approval - and the property's north-facing aspect was a selling point.
Mrs Stanley said the home had hosted visitors of the likes of popular television veterans Dr Harry, and "Chris Brown has used my toilet", she laughed.
